Subject: DR drill notes — webhook retry semantics (for weekly sync)

Team, during Thursday's disaster-recovery drill on the Hollowgate delivery tier, we confirmed webhooks retry with exponential backoff capped at six attempts, and duplicates are possible after failover. Consumers must dedupe on delivery ID. Replaying the dead-letter backlog requires unsealing the drill vault, which accepts the recovery passphrase given directly below.

recovery phrase for fajeg-hagug: holox-fenmir

## Payroll Export Changes

Welcome to the Tallygrove team. As of this quarter, payroll exports moved from fixed-width files to the PX2 columnar format consumed by the Bramwick clearing service. New joiners should read `docs/px2-spec.md` before touching the exporter, since field ordering is contractually fixed. Local runs require `PX2_OUTPUT_DIR` and `PX2_LOCALE` in your env file, and the clearing service's signing secret belongs on the line immediately below this sentence.

env line for fafof-fahag: LEDGER_TOKEN5=f8790

## Pinning your dependencies

Welcome, plugin folks! Quick rule for the Thimbleworks plugin registry: pin everything. Exact versions in your lockfile, no ranges, no "latest." Our CI rebuilds your plugin weekly, and floating deps are the number one cause of mystery breakage. If you need an upgrade, bump it deliberately and note it in your changelog. Once your lockfile is in shape, you'll publish through the registry CLI, which reads its env file for config. The publish step authenticates with a token, set here:

sealed setting: RELAY_SECRET13=bca49b02a6971

Handing off the Quillbus broker upgrade (4.x to 5.1) to Dario. Cluster is half-migrated; mixed-version mode is supported but TLS cert rotation must finish before cutover. No auth model changes, though the admin API gained two new endpoints worth reviewing. Open questions and the migration checklist are tracked on the internal page below.

dashboard of taduf-bawef = https://jira.lumicsys.internal/projects/display/browse/b1cbf89d